Lophozia 1a oil bodies more than 15 per cell > Lophozia 2b underleaves absent > Lophozia 3b gemmae angular > Lophozia 4
4a Leaves 1 or rarely 2-3 stratose at base; perianth mouth with abundant teeth 1-3 (4) cells long, the longer cells thick-walled; spores (10) 12-15 mm; common on decaying wood at all elevations
Lophozia incisa
4b Leaves 2-3 or 4-5 stratose at base; perianth mouth subentire to denticulate, the teeth 1 celled and not greatly thickened; spores mostly 18-21 mm; on peaty soil at high elevations
Lophozia opacifolia
